Vital Energy - Shakti
We have discussed the ground of Reality as comprising five dimensions
of true nature. We can conceptualize Reality slightly differently;
by taking into consideration some important differentiations and
distinctions in manifest reality. We have discussed the manifest
forms as if they are all of the same kind, or on the same level;
but there are physical forms, mental forms, emotional forms, essential
forms, and so on. It might be helpful to differentiate two significant
categories and explore how they are related to true nature. We
then can speak of two additional dimensions to Reality, the physical
dimension and the dimension of energy. Reality then comprises
seven dimensions, the five boundless dimensions of true nature
and the dimensions of energy and physicality. We are not referring
here to physical energy, which is part of the physical world.
Rather, we mean the vital energy necessary for living forms, referred
to in Sanskrit as prana or shakti… In
the Diamond Approach we activate this vital energy not through
the familiar yogic practices of kundalini but through
inquiry and understanding. Our perception is that shakti
energy is a dimension that is patterned according to essential
aspects, a dimension that has its particular psychodynamic and
structural issues. In other words, it is a dimension of presence;
but this presence is the presence of energy, like light but not
exactly. It has no fullness or density, just vitality. (Inner
Journey Home, pg 444)
